The New York City Housing Authority’s (“NYCHA”) Asset and Capital Management Division is seeking input (“Responses”) from manufacturers and suppliers of auger compactors and interior compactors on a proposed Master Equipment Supply Agreement.
Under this new procurement approach, NYCHA would enter into an agreement with a qualified manufacturer or supplier, establishing pre-negotiated terms, conditions, and unit pricing for equipment to be supplied across multiple NYCHA developments. NYCHA’s project-specific installation contractors would issue Purchase Orders against the agreement as equipment is needed, while payment obligations to the supplier would remain with NYCHA.

Through this RFI, NYCHA is seeking industry Responses to help refine the proposed agreement and procurement approach before proceeding with a future solicitation.
This document is not a solicitation. NYCHA will not award a contract based on the responses to this RFI and a response to this RFI is not required in order to respond to any subsequent solicitation issued by NYCHA. A response to this RFI will not result in any preference or advantage in any subsequent competitive procurement.
